Trevor Byrne Founder & Judge

Trevor is the founder and host of The Bucket Seat and podcast, and a wildly passionate car lover and content consumer. 

Born and raised in Southern Ontario he was exposed to an expected array of automotive experiences, but while attending the Automotive Business School of Canada, the aperture truly opened. He has since had nearly two decades of experience working and creating content directly for major OEM's, ad agencies, and independent automotive publishers.

Laurance Yap
Judge

Laurance has been playing with cars since he was a kid – Hot Wheels and Lego from birth, with a transition to full-sized versions while he was in university. While getting a degree in creative writing, he began his automotive career, spending over a decade as an auto journalist, writing and photographing for various outlets while also holding down part-time jobs as an IT consultant and graphic artist.

He spent six years at Porsche Canada as public relations manager and marketing director, has worked at RM Sotheby’s as marketing director, and is currently creative director at Pfaff Automotive Partners, a Toronto-based retail group. There, he has a hand in marketing as well as other corporate strategy and business development projects

Bonar Bulgar

Judge

 

Bonar is the founder and CEO of Steak+Sizzle Media Co., a dedicated content production house focusing on the automotive vertical. 

 

He grew up in England, and his father's hobby was buying Mercedes-SL vehicles, ones that had a bit of rust or needed some minor repair. He'd fix them and then sell them. They'd often go for car rides in the evening, and they'd look for cars like Jaguars XJS and the like and pretend to race them. His dad is also a photography nerd; he'd always have new photography gear lying around the house. Fast forward 40 years, and Bonar runs a media company focused on the automotive vertical. He has essentially taken these impressionable elements of his youth and combined them into a career - cameras + cars.
